Understanding Data: A Comprehensive Overview

What is Data?

Data is basically raw information. It can come in many forms: numbers, words, pictures, or sounds. On its own, data doesn’t tell us much, but when we analyze it, we can uncover useful insights.

Data falls into two main types:

Qualitative Data: This is descriptive data that tells us about qualities or characteristics. It’s often not in numerical form. For example, if people describe their experiences with a product, they might talk about how it feels, looks, or tastes. This type of data helps us understand people’s opinions and experiences.

Quantitative Data: This data is all about numbers. It includes anything that can be measured or counted. For example, how many products were sold, the temperature today, or how many people visited a website. This type of data helps us identify patterns and make predictions.
The Role of Data in Statistics

Statistics is a way of using math to understand data. The Collection of data in statistics is a fundamental process that involves gathering information to understand phenomena or answer research questions. Here’s how it works:

Data Collection: This is the first step where we gather information. It can be done through surveys, experiments, or observations. We collect both qualitative (descriptive) and quantitative (numerical) data based on what we want to find out.
Data Analysis: After gathering data, we analyze it to find patterns and trends. For numbers, this might mean calculating averages or looking for correlations. For descriptions, it might involve finding common themes or categories.
Data Interpretation: This step involves making sense of the analyzed data. We use it to draw conclusions and make decisions.
Data Presentation: Finally, we present the results in a way that’s easy to understand, such as through charts or graphs.

Why is Data Important?

Data is very valuable because:
It Helps Us Make Decisions: Accurate data allows us to make better choices and reduce uncertainty.
It Reveals Trends: By analyzing data, we can spot trends and make predictions.
It Solves Problems: Data helps us identify issues and find solutions, whether it’s improving a product or understanding a health condition.
It Drives Innovation: Data can uncover new opportunities and lead to new ideas or improvements.
